Oxygen Deficit
Oxygen necessary for the synthesis of the ATP required to remove lactic acid produced by anaerobic respiration.
Conducting System
A network in the heart that electrically controls and coordinates heart muscle contractions.
SA Node
The sinoatrial node, a group of cells in the right atrium of the heart that acts as a natural pacemaker by initiating the heart's electrical impulses.
Purkinje Fibers
Specialized conducting fibers located in the heart's ventricles that help regulate the heart's rhythm.
